KPMG is currently seeking a Manager to join our Mergers & Acquisitions (M&A) Tax practice. As a Manager, you will advise clients on a full spectrum of corporate tax services, including planning, research, and other mergers and acquisitions activities.
Responsibilities:- Advise clients on a full spectrum of corporate tax services, including planning, research, and other mergers and acquisitions activities.
- Work as a part of a multi-disciplinary team that focuses on delivering due diligence and tax structuring services, and communicates findings and opportunities to clients.
- Collaborate with and assist other senior members of the M&A Tax practice with various technical tax issues dealing with consolidated returns, S Corps, partnerships, LLCs, and LLPs.
- Assist clients with current issues, which may include bankruptcy emergence planning, out of court workouts, debt restructurings, tax basis, earning and profits, and section 382 studies.
- Develop, motivate, and train staff-level team members.
- Minimum five years of recent experience in federal tax and/or mergers and acquisition in a public accounting firm, corporate tax department, or law firm.
- Bachelor's degree from an accredited college/university.
- Licensed CPA, EA, or JD/LLM, in addition to others on KPMG's approved credential listing.
- Knowledge of a broad range of corporate tax matters in various industries.
- Ability to handle multiple engagements and client service teams.
- Excellent research and writing skills.
